Designers, marketers, and small teams who want to build and publish a professional website visually, without writing code.
A canvas-based design tool for building responsive websites with animations and interactive components, an integrated CMS for structured content, and built-in hosting, SEO, and analytics. It includes an AI agent that can generate or edit site components and set up the CMS, and originated from an interactive prototyping tool, so it also supports design/prototyping work before a site goes live.
You design pages on a visual canvas (or prompt the AI agent to generate/edit them), connect content through the CMS, then publish directly from the platform, which handles hosting without a separate deployment step.
